  • Lot# : 2087 Cape of Good Hope

    1858: 6 d. pale rose-lilac, two single examples, one very fine the other imperceptibly shaved on one margin, used on 1860 double rate cover endorsed 'per R.M.S. Norman' to Romsey, Hampshire, tied by CGH triangular handstamps in black. Reverse with 'Cape Town / Cape of Good Hope' despatch datestamp (Feb 21) in red. Obverse with PAID / DEVONPORT / CAPE PACKET datestamp (April 1) and London cds of the following day. Romsey arrival (April 2) in black on reverse. Manuscript crayon '10' (pence) credit in red also on front of a fine and scarce cover.
